Small and Medium Enterprises (SMEs) are the engine of Ethiopia’s growth, yet they face a staggering $6.1 billion financing gap. Beyond just the lack of credit, SMEs suffer from a lack of specialized service. A business owner needing to discuss a Letter of Credit or a trade finance loan often has to stand in the same queue as a retail customer making a small withdrawal.


This is a failure of segmentation. SMEs are high-value, time-poor clients. Bank-Genie empowers banks to treat them that way. Through our system, Bank of Abyssinia can identify SME clients the moment they walk in the door—or even before, if they book an appointment via mobile.

The system automatically routes these business owners to specialized relationship managers, bypassing the general teller queues. This VIP treatment does two things: it respects the business owner's time, and it increases the bank’s conversion rate on high-value lending products, directly addressing the market failure in SME finance.
